The leadership of Agbor Community Union headed by Mr. Larry Onyeche on Saturday, June 6, 2020 inaugurated 7 standing committees for effective operation of the union.
Speaking at the brief meeting held at the union ‘s hall for the inaugural ceremony, the Secretary to the union, Dr. Onyemechi Ugboh, named the various committees to include Cultural committee, Political Committee, Security Committee, Education Committee, Peace and Conflict Resolution Committee, Health/Environmental Committee and Works Project/Monitoring Committee, and in the same vein read out terms of reference for the constituted committees.

In his remark, the PG, Mr. Larry Onyeche, expressed joy to have the standing committees finally constituted.
He charged the committees to commence operations in line with their schedule of duties and within the context of the ACU constitution.
He enjoined the committee heads to report back to him their activities for onward directives of the committee chairman to brief the house from time to time.
The PG emphasized that any committee that fails to perform within the first two quarters ending in December, 2020, will be dissolved and be subsequently replaced with new set of persons. Hence his directive to all committee chairmen not to hesitate in reporting any inactive member to ACU secretariat for necessary actions.
Speaking further, the PG posited that all committees are at liberty to meet at least once in a month, adding that they are also free to use the community hall for their meetings.
“We wish to note that we are all in the community service together where we spend our time, energy and finance to collectively assist in the development of our kingdom in our little way. However, your short, middle and long term plan of your activities must be drawn and approved by the executive members,” he added.
He therefore, proceeded to inaugurate the committees on the assurance that the Chairmen will live up to expectations by serving their respective committees diligently.
